Jo In Sung and Do Sang Woo started to have a fight.

On the 10th episode of SBS Wednesday/Thursday drama "It's Okay It's Love" (director Kim Kyu Tae, script No Hee Kyung) broadcast on August 21st, Jang Je Yeol (played by Jo In Sung) met Choi Ho (played by Do Sang Woo).

Choi Ho was creating a documentary with Jang Je Yeol and Jang Jae Beom (played by Yang Ik Joon)'s incident. Because of Ji Hye Soo (played by Gong Hyo Jin)'s ex-boyfriend, the current boyfriend and the mental conflict even worsened.

Choi Ho said, "This is not a decision that I made.  It's a decision that was made from above" and he made a joke.  Jang Je Yeol saw this from afar and said, "The most suspicious thing is the sentence.  There is no evidence and there is no legal parameters but there is 11 years of sentencing.  Please, do me a favor and get rid of this framing. Then I'll respect you."  Then, he said, "Please stop appearing in front of Hye Soo."

Meanwhile, "It's Okay, It's Love" stars Jo In Sung, Gong Hyo Jin, Lee Kwang Soo, Sung Dong Il, and EXO's D.O. It's a story about how the members of the younger generation experience all kinds of pain and troubles both inside and out, and how they come to deal with these everyday issues. It airs every Wednesday and Thursday on SBS.
